No other race had more ballots cast in Howell County than the contest between Matt Roberts and Brent Campbell for Sheriff. Roberts emerged victorious on Primary Election Day with 69.99% of the vote to Campbell’s 30.01%. There are no Democratic candidates to defeat in November.

Two Republican contenders for the Missouri Senate seat lately vacated by Karla Eslinger ran a hotly contested race leading up to last Tuesday’s Primary. Brad Hudson emerged victorious over Travis Smith with 52.6% of the vote across the seven-county district, according to results from the Missouri...
